Wilderness Orientation | FAQ’s

GENERAL QUESTIONS

Q:   What is Wilderness Orientation (WO) all about? Who can attend these trips?

A:  WO is a great opportunity for incoming students to get oriented to campus, learn some life skills, make lasting friendships, and unplug before starting school at UCSD. All non-specified WO trips are open to incoming first years and incoming transfer students. Transfer students are also able to sign up for our transfer specific program. Incoming medical students are welcome on our Pre-Op Outdoor Experience.

Q:   Does Wilderness Orientation take the place of College Orientation?

A:  No, Wilderness Orientation is a supplemental program that will help you learn life skills and facilitate you meeting new friends, but it does not replace your mandatory college orientation.

Q:   Can I sign up for these trips as a minor?

A:  Minors are welcome to sign up for any of our trips. Since we require a waiver signature, a minor cannot sign up using their own Recreation account. Here is an outline of the process to register through a parent/guardian:

1.      Parent/guardian must sign up for a recreation.ucsd.edu community account. Please fill out all required fields when signing up. This will trigger an email confirmation. Follow the link to confirm your account.

2.      Sign into your account and click your name on the top right corner, then click profile. Scroll to the bottom and click on “add dependent”

3.      Fill out the dependent’s information – this should be the incoming student currently under 18 years old. Please include their email address and phone number.

4.      Once your dependent is saved, you should also create a payment method. This will make the check-out process easier. On the left of the profile page, click on the last link, “saved payment info” and select “save a new card,” then save your info.

5.      Now you can sign up for a trip! Make your selection on the website, click register, and be sure to select “register” next to the incoming student’s name.

6.      Complete the remaining information and process your payment. Congratulations! We can’t wait to see you on a WO trip soon!

Q:  I see that your trips are “technology free” – what does this mean? What if there is an emergency in the field or back home?

A:  Our WO trips take place in fairly remote areas where there is often no cell service. We like to take advantage of being “away from it all” and connecting with our group members in the present moment. All participants will leave cell phones and other communication devices behind (and secured) at Outback, but trip leaders will carry multiple forms of communication to contact our office in case of emergencies or other incidents. These devices are mostly used in one direction, so there is rarely an opportunity to hear updates from us while you are on your trip.

Q:  Why are trips priced differently? What is included with the cost?

A:  Our prices cover the cost of transportation, food, camping permits, staff, and more– these will vary depending on the location, activity, and duration of the trip. This cost does not cover your personal gear, although you will be able to rent specific items from our rental shop at a reduced cost. We keep our prices as low as we can to stay accessible to as many students as possible. Keep in mind, our prices increase on July 1st  and August 1st so be sure to sign up soon.

Q:  Is there an opportunity to receive financial assistance for a WO trip?

A:  Yes, we have financial assistance available for first generation college students, students from low income families, non-resident/out of state students, and international students (F1/J1). If you believe you qualify for any of these categories, please fill out a WO Financial Assistance Application.  Financial assistance is limited and awarded on a first come first served basis. Please apply accordingly. Students who apply for financial assistance but are not awarded it, can cancel program enrollment and receive a 100% refund if cancellation within 7 days of notification. The WO refund policy applies to cancellations made after this 7 day grace period.
